Output 56e1bf72497298aa5b5e079421c17a2950f4002d7bc0e0df808443391f4da7dc:1

value
33857249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 540cb2d121487af7ba0370a726c89e9f8684b030 OP_EQUAL
address
39MRtxvXiopo4Lu3XKK6bPJE6Evc4zj5Je
transaction
56e1bf72497298aa5b5e079421c17a2950f4002d7bc0e0df808443391f4da7dc
confirmations
267807
spent
true